also known as 100 miles on a Zuumer, in one day, up and down the hills of Big Sur…
As dramatic as the Golden Gate was, today takes the prize for shear, stunning beauty. Travelling virtually silently let us hear the sounds of crashing waves, pelicans, and sea lions. Climbing the steep hills around Big Sur tested the Zuumer better than most labs could (and let us ’surf’ down the long descents).

When I think of Santa Cruz, two images come to mind - surfboards and bicycles. We saw plenty of surfers, waves, boards, and lots of people getting around town on scooters, bicycles, and mopeds.
The “Share the Road” signs were particularly encouraging as was the well marked asphalt. Lots of miles today, we were thankful to be able to stop for a few pictures…

Apart from many, many test drives on (and across!) the Google campus - we played a game we like to call “Spot the EV”. Electric Vehicles abound on the beautiful campus - ranging from brand new Tesla Roadsters to electric bicycles, scooters and more Prius Hybrids than we could count. It is refreshing to see an innovative, respected company support the technology!
